Compare scotia itrade vs Oinvest Commission And Fees
scotia itrade and Oinvest are online broker platforms, and many online brokerages charge lower fees than traditional brokerages tend to charge. The cause of this is that the businesses of online brokerages are scaled better. That is, an internet broker is not necessarily influenced by the amount of clients they have.
But this doesn't mean that online brokers don't charge any fees. They charge fees of varying rates for various services to earn money. There are mainly three types of fees for this purpose.
The first kind of fees to look out for are trading charges. Whenever you make an actual trade, like purchasing a stock or an ETF, you're billed trading fees. In these instances, you are paying a spread, funding rate, or a commission. The kinds of trading fees and the prices vary from broker to broker.
Commissions could be fixed or dependent on the traded volume. On the other hand, a spread denotes the gap between the buying and selling price. Financing or overnight prices are people that are charged when you hold a leveraged position for longer than a day.
Apart from trading fees, online agents also bill non-trading fees. These are dependent on the activities you undertake in your accounts. They are billed for surgeries like depositing money, not trading for lengthy periods, or withdrawals.
